Neonatal Herpes Simplex Viral Infections and Acyclovir: An Update
Summary
Neonatal herpes simplex virus (HSV) infections are serious, requiring optimized treatment and prevention. Parenteral acyclovir is key, but high mortality persists, highlighting the need for improved care strategies.

Main Results:
- Neonatal HSV infections are categorized as localized (skin, eyes, mouth), central nervous system, or disseminated.
- Parenteral acyclovir is the primary treatment, with dosage and duration varying by severity and presentation.
- Oral acyclovir may be used for suppressive therapy to reduce neurodevelopmental issues and future outbreaks.
Conclusions:
- Despite treatment with acyclovir, mortality rates for neonatal HSV remain high.
- Optimizing acyclovir dosage, duration, and suppressive therapy is essential.
- Further research and improved strategies are needed to reduce the impact of neonatal HSV infections.
